Selected Dohas

This book is meant to introduce the reader to the famous 'dohas' of five Hindi poets: Kabir, Tulsi, Rahim Khankhana' Varind Kavi and Sheikh Farid. The book contains 523 'dohas', which have been thoughtfully selected and faithfully rendered into English language, lucid, rhythmical and appropriate. The translation attempts to retain the beauty of rhyme and assonance, the special features of a 'dohas', which account for their musicality and memorability.

Each poet is first introduced with a brief biographical-cum-critical note which gives a foretaste of the 'dohas' to come.

The book begins with a general introduction to the form and features of the 'Dohas', which is fairly comprehensive and informative. Then follow the series of selected 'dohas' in Hindi, their transcription in the Roman script, and their translation into English. It is hoped that this book will be warmly received by lovers of literature, including especially those readers who are not familiar with Hindi in the Devnagri script.

About the author

K.C. Kanda

18 books5 followers
Kishan Chand Kanda has had a long and distinguished tenure as a Reader in English at Delhi University. He holds a doctorate in English from Delhi University, Master’s degrees in English from Punjab University and Nottingham University, and a first class first M. A. degree in Urdu from Delhi University. He has published 10 books of Urdu poetry translations and is the recipient of the Urdu Academy Award for excellence in translation.
